1. Handling Dangerous Goods for Canada Shipping

When shipping dangerous goods, such as chemicals, batteries, or other hazardous items, it’s crucial to follow specific guidelines to ensure the safety of the shipment. Here’s what you need to know:

  • Classify Dangerous Goods: Ensure the goods are correctly classified according to international safety standards.
  • Packaging Requirements: Dangerous goods must be packaged in compliance with Canada shipping regulations to prevent any accidents or leaks during transit.
  • Labeling & Documentation: Proper labeling of hazardous items is a must. Make sure to include all necessary safety information, such as the UN number, and ensure the paperwork is complete.
  • Choose the Right Carrier: Not all shipping companies accept dangerous goods. Ensure your freight carrier is certified to handle hazardous materials.

2. Import Clearance Guide for Canada Shipping

Navigating the import clearance process is a crucial step in getting your goods from China to Canada. Here are the key steps to ensure smooth customs clearance:

  • Prepare Documentation: Make sure all required documents, such as commercial invoices, packing lists, and certificates of origin, are prepared and accurate.
  • Classify Products with HS Codes: Use the correct Harmonized System (HS) codes for your products. Accurate HS codes are essential for determining duties and taxes on your shipment.
  • Duties and Taxes: Be aware of the applicable duties and taxes for importing goods into Canada. For instance, dangerous goods may require additional fees for safe transport.
  • Customs Broker: Consider working with a customs broker to help you navigate the complexities of import clearance for Canada shipping.
